Transaction 3ef74bf649c92bd53a7cb5f9f7c6d057e572161fcdcf60b46d6768c43a26fecf
1 Input
1 Output
-
3ef74bf649c92bd53a7cb5f9f7c6d057e572161fcdcf60b46d6768c43a26fecf:0
- value
- 5693802
- script pubkey
- OP_0 OP_PUSHBYTES_20 386b4ab9608ddb6e28b56aa08fcf6c1341878499
- address
- bc1q8p454wtq3hdku294d2sglnmvzdqc0pyefncjl6